引言
近年来,加密货币市场的迅速崛起吸引了数百万人的关注。随着比特币、以太坊等主流数字货币的成功,越来越多的人希望了解如何自己创造一种加密货币。创建加密货币不仅是一项技术挑战,更是一个法律、经济和社会行为。在这一过程中,潜在的投资者和开发者需要考虑很多因素,包括目标受众、技术架构、市场需求和法律框架。
加密货币的基本概念
加密货币是一种基于区块链技术的数字货币,它使用密码学技术来确保交易安全和控制新单位的生成。最重要的是,加密货币运作在去中心化的网络上,这也就意味着一个中央机构(如银行)并不控制它。
加密货币的分类
我们可以根据不同的标准对加密货币进行分类。一般来说,有以下几种常见的分类:
- 平台币:如以太坊,提供了智能合约功能。
- 稳定币:如USDT,与法定货币挂钩,降低波动性。
- 隐私币:如门罗币,专注于提升用户隐私。
- 原生币:如比特币,专注于作为一种交换媒介。
创建加密货币的步骤
1. 确定加密货币的目的与功能
首先要问自己的是,为什么要创建这种加密货币?是为了交易、转账,还是想实现某种特定机制或服务?把目标明确化能帮助你在后面的步骤中更好地进行设计。
2. 选择合适的区块链平台
可以选择使用现有的区块链平台(如以太坊、波卡等)来发行代币,或者创建自己的区块链。如果选择后者,你需要深入了解技术细节,可能需要一支技术团队来进行开发。
3. 设计架构与功能
在这一阶段,开发者需要设计加密货币的技术架构,包括共识机制(如工作量证明或权益证明)、交易确认时间、代币总供应量等。在这方面,有很多技术文档和开源代码可以参考。
4. 开发与编码
如果你选择创建自己的区块链,你将需要强大的编码能力。您可以使用多种编程语言进行开发,最受欢迎的包括C 、Python和Solidity等。此步骤可以参考开源资源,也可以雇佣开发者。
5. 进行测试
创建了一个原型后,务必进行全面的测试。这包括安全性测试,以确保没有漏洞存在,以及功能测试,以确保每个部分都能正常运作。
6. 发布与推广
在确认加密货币的功能和安全性后,就可以考虑上线了。但上线并不是结束,你还需要进行市场推广,让更多的用户了解你的项目,比如通过社交媒体、社区活动、交易所上市等方式。
7. 持续更新与维护
成功的加密货币项目不会在发布后就停止工作。维护团队需要不断更新和改进,处理用户反馈与安全问题。
加密货币的法律与合规性
在全球范围内,加密货币的法律地位各异。某些国家接纳并规范加密货币,而另一些国家则视其为非法。因此,理解当地的法律法规非常重要。您可能需要咨询法律专家,以确保符合所有要求。
加密货币的未来发展趋势
有些趋势正在改变加密货币的面貌,这些趋势可以帮助您更好地把握未来:
- DeFi(去中心化金融):去中心化金融正在成为新的投资和交易热点,提供贷款、保险等金融服务。
- NFT(非同质化代币):NFT正在蓬勃发展,提供了数字资产的真实性和稀缺性。
- 合规化: 越来越多的国家意识到加密货币的潜力,因此开始制定相关法规,帮助市场发展。
- 二层解决方案: 如闪电网络等,旨在提高交易速度和降低成本。
可能相关的问题
1. 创建加密货币是否需要大量资金?
这是一个普遍关心的问题。实际上,创建加密货币的成本可以是非常多样的。使用现有区块链创建代币比较便宜,而搭建自己的独立区块链需要更多的资源和开发能力。如果你能够自己编程,同时懂得市场需求,可能会显著节省一些费用。不过,要有一点意识到,低成本往往意味着在营销和用户需求研判上的不足。因此,我真心建议:做好全面的市场分析和预算规划。
2. 数字货币的投资风险有哪些?
投资加密货币并非没有风险。包括市场波动性、技术问题、法律风险等。同时,我觉得有人会不经意将投资视为“快速致富”的渠道,然而,这其中潜藏的风险常常让人有点遗憾。在任何情况下,投资者都应该对自身的风险承受能力进行评估,谨慎投资。
### 结论创建加密货币是一个充满挑战的过程,但也是一个有无限可能的领域。希望通过上述的内容能帮助有志于此的人们更好地理解所需的步骤以及未来的发展趋势。无论是出于个人兴趣还是商业考虑,理解加密货币的方方面面,都会让你在这个不断变化和发展的领域中占得先机。
